Tiger and Lemon's Story

This is Tiger (left) and Lemon. They are 6 months old now and spent grew up outside and came to me at close to 12 weeks. As such they are very shy and skittish at first, but warm up with treats and play. These two are a close pair, but can be adopted separately as long as they have other friendly cats. They love to chase, play with toys, and give lots of loud purrs when in their 'bed'. They're not super cuddly with people, but it's growing on them. These boys love cuddling together in cubbies and getting loved on while cuddling. <br/><br/>Tiger is bolder than his buff colored brother, Lemon. True to their shark inspired names, Lemon is shy and quick to go hide in or under something while Tiger will skitter out of reach, but come back around for a toy or treat. Their favorite thing is chasing each other or their mom through the house and jumping through the air at each other. The next best things are wand toys, especially with feathers, bouncy balls, springs. And I almost forgot their adoration for destroying a roll of toilet paper! They are a joy to have around.<br/><br/>They are very tolerant of other cats.
